Hi,

Has anyone managed to get the CCS ported tcp/ip stack to work with the PIC24E series?

I am using a PIC24EP512GP806 connected to an ENC28J60.

I am using EX13b as test code and have had this code working successfully on the CCS Ethernet development board which uses a PIC18F.

I have written my own register map to allow the stack to work with the PIC24E that I am using and have checked this over and over. I have also modified enc28j60.c to make sure that the SPI bus is clocking at the correct frequency and added my own hardware configuration in ccstcpip.h.

I have checked that the SPI bus is working correctly with an oscilloscope and there is data being sent and received.

As far as I can tell my hardware is ok (famous last words) but what I would like to know is if anyone has got the stack working with a PIC24E and if they have what/if anything have they had to modify?

I have now spoken to CCS and they have answered my question for the time being. The CCS ported version of the TCP/IP stack does not currently work with the PIC24E family. It is something that they are aware of and I think it is something that they are slowly working on.

It has been suggested that there may be a timing issue causing the problem.

If anyone has solved this please let CCS know and myself so that the TCP/IP stack can be updated for everyone to use.
